Output 3529039f93a2e3a69aa01e699156f33e1e531723b79898273837493d2959e16a:5

value
56526
script pubkey
OP_0 OP_PUSHBYTES_20 e63c20a849a6c62d03c5a23dbddfd3d91e9e95a0
address
bc1quc7zp2zf5mrz6q795g7mmh7nmy0fa9dq8r6mlw
transaction
3529039f93a2e3a69aa01e699156f33e1e531723b79898273837493d2959e16a
spent
true